Faith, in the narrative woven by Hashimi, is not a stagnant entity but a dynamic interplay between knowledge and experience. He asserts that knowledge is the foundation upon which faith is built, urging his followers to engage in lifelong learning. In Hashimi’s dialectical perspective, ignorance begets misguided beliefs; hence, the pursuit of knowledge forms a vital conduit through which believers may access divine wisdom.
One might envision his teachings as a vast ocean— knowledge serving as the buoyant vessel through which faith navigates uncharted waters. Hashimi’s call for intellectual exploration extends to all domains of life—from theology to science— there exists no boundaries, only opportunities for holistic understanding. By nurturing both faith and rational inquiry, Hashimi beckons his followers towards a more comprehensive and fulfilling spiritual existence.
